summ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2009-09-07While the display-panes indicator is on screen, make the number keys select theNicholas Marriott
pane with that index.
2009-09-07Reference count clients and sessions rather than relying on a saved index forNicholas Marriott
cmd-choose-*.
2009-09-07Don't print package comment when -q is given, and no other option isLandry Breuil
used. This way, pkg_info -q only shows installed pkgnames.. and can replace `ls /var/db/pkg` in scripts. ok espie@
2009-09-07Cross-reference ipgphy(4), from Brad.Stuart Henderson
2009-09-07Add another umass-to-modem request type which is needed forMarco Pfatschbacher
the Novatel MC950D. Input & ok jsg; ok fkr, deraadt.
2009-09-07Sync mplock code with the current paradigm used in all other MP platforms.Miod Vallat
macppc was left unchanged by mistake.
2009-09-07Tiny cleanup.Matthias Kilian
ok nicm@
2009-09-07sizeof ptr vs sizeof *ptr bug; ok mglocker@Miod Vallat
2009-09-07Give each paste buffer a size member instead of requiring them to beNicholas Marriott
zero-terminated.
2009-09-07syncStuart Henderson
2009-09-07Correct the PHY ID for IC+ IP1001. From Brad, confirmed with the datasheet.Stuart Henderson
2009-09-07Teach the printer about capabilities, new cease codes, end-of-rib marker,Stuart Henderson
and handle 32-bit ASN. ok claudio@
2009-09-07implement binat-to as a macro-like rule: a rule using the new binat-toReyk Floeter
syntax will be expanded by the parser to a nat-to+rdr-to combination to be loaded into the kernel. this simplifies the migration from old binat rules and is less error-prone. feedback from many, manpage bits from jmc@ ok henning@
2009-09-07remove the trans-anchors bnf entry too; ok sthen henningJason McIntyre
2009-09-07Permit embedded colour and attributes in status-left and status-right using newNicholas Marriott
#[] special characters, for example #[fg=red,bg=blue,blink].
2009-09-07remove *-anchor bits from BNF; ok sthenJason McIntyre
2009-09-07example spamd rules should be "pass in";Jason McIntyre
2009-09-07the example pf rules should be "pass in", not just "pass"; ok henningJason McIntyre
2009-09-07rdr -> rdr-toJason McIntyre
from Karl-Heinz Wild
2009-09-07Fix static-port, found by jmc@. ok henning@.Stuart Henderson
2009-09-06Don't pass uninitialized stack memory to setdisklabel() as the 'old'Kenneth R Westerback
label. Use the existing label, since we now check and reuse some values in it. And that's what all other drivers do. Bonus: we don't need that label on the stack anymore. ok deraadt@
2009-09-06Attach devices to obio(4) based on information from the flattened deviceMark Kettenis
tree. Since that information is also used for the PCI interrupts, devices in mini-PCI slots should work now as well, at least in the rb600.
2009-09-06Implement OF_getproplen().Mark Kettenis
2009-09-06syncTheo de Raadt
2009-09-06add framework for palmTheo de Raadt
2009-09-06check for unitialized elements when accessing an array; from Simon Kellner.Otto Moerbeek
2009-09-06Fix typo in comment, safe -> save.Marcus Glocker
Spotted by miod@
2009-09-06Fix udl_copycols overlay copy problem by copying area to off-screen firstMarcus Glocker
(same as in udl_copyrows).
2009-09-06When dvmrpd receives a prune, it must checks if every downstream memberMichele Marchetto
on that interfaces has already sent prunes. If so (and there are no local groups) removes the interface from the downstream list. ok claudio@
2009-09-06Palm: cleanup kernel configuration filesMarek Vasut
2009-09-05Make use of the new wsdisplay ability, committed by miod previously, whichMarcus Glocker
allows our rasops functions to return EAGAIN if our usb command queue is full. This gets us rid of the ugly while { delay(); } loop and makes udl work also on MP kernels now (we faced a deadlock so far because spinning in that delay() loop with biglock active wasn't that much fun). With help from miod@
2009-09-05Only redraw all clients once when the backoff timer expires rather than everyNicholas Marriott
second all the time. Reported by Simon Nicolussi.
2009-09-05- don't try to shove a daddr64_t value into an int32_t.Jasper Lievisse Adriaanse
eventhough this won't really harm as ext2fs doesn't handle files that large, it was not correct. no objections from thib@
2009-09-05Buglet crept in.Miod Vallat
2009-09-05sync comment to reality, off-page page headers go intoThordur I. Bjornsson
an RB tree, not into a hashtable.
2009-09-05u_int32_t not u_int32_ts in debug code.Claudio Jeker
2009-09-05fix typosTheo de Raadt
2009-09-05Check the return value of all emulops in the emulation code, and abortMiod Vallat
tty output as soon as we hit a failure. Since the `output' of a character may cause several emulops to be called (e.g. if it causes scrollup or if this is the end of an escape sequence), all emulation code maintain a so-called `abort state', to be able to properly recover when the character is tentatively output later, and not reissue the emulops which did not fail the first time. With help from mglocker@
2009-09-05Make the output() wsemul_op return the number of characters processed andMiod Vallat
check it in wsdisplaystart() to suspend output if not all characters have been output; they will get reissued at the next tty rstrt_to timeout.
2009-09-05Change the wsdisplay_emulops return types from void to int; emulops will nowMiod Vallat
return zero on success and nonzero on failure. This commit only performs mechanical changes for the existing emulops to always return zero.
2009-09-05- properly free fqdn if it gets reassigned due to multiple -h optionsTobias Stoeckmann
- fixed comment typos with input by and ok millert, otto
2009-09-05Rework internal interfaces in the wsdisplay emulation code to prepare forMiod Vallat
upcoming changes. No functional change.
2009-09-05scsi_done before COMPLETEDavid Gwynne
2009-09-05scsi_done before COMPLETE.David Gwynne
2009-09-05call scsi_done before returning COMPLETEDavid Gwynne
2009-09-05call scsi_done before returning COMPLETE in the stuffup case.David Gwynne
pointed out by miod
2009-09-05Fixed typo in comment.Tobias Stoeckmann
ok millert
2009-09-05Fix various cases of stackgap_alloc() size arguments not being computedMiod Vallat
correctly, usually yielding the right value on 32 bit machines because sizeof int == sizeof pointer.
2009-09-05Make sure ehci_open() invokes ehci_device_setintr() at splusb; found withMiod Vallat
splassert.
2009-09-05Remove unnecessary assignments in sii311[24]_chip_map().Miod Vallat